View Point Health Child and Adolescent (C&A) Crisis Stabilization Program is a short-term, 24/7 residential crisis unit located in Decatur, Ga. The Crisis Stabilization program provides psychiatric crisis intervention and stabilization services to adolescents between the ages of 14 and 17 years old.

 

We are looking for a master's Level Behavioral Health Clinician to join our multi-disciplinary team as an Admissions Clinician to provide screening/review of referrals for admission and assessment of psychiatric/addictions risk/needs of individuals referred for care. We provide person-centered care and assist with implementing our unit programming based on Dialectical Behavior Therapy.

 

The Admissions Clinician Triage provides a variety of routine clinical and administrative functions for the Crisis Stabilization Unit programs.  Duties are typically performed in a fast-paced environment that requires multi-tasking. 

 

A Crisis Stabilization Unit (CSU) operates 24 hours/7 days a week (including weekends and holidays) to provide a safe, structured, and locked environment for clients experiencing a mental health crisis. The services are like residential treatment but provide a higher level of care due to our acuity of the clients who are in crisis. Our units operate much like a psychiatric hospital.

 

A client typically stays with us about 30 days to ensure he/she is stable from the prompting event of their crisis prior to discharge.  Clients do not leave the facility during their stay with us.
